FTHM — legal / regulatory event — Notice of Delisting or Failure to Satisfy a Continued Listing Rule or Standar…
Dated 2026-08-24
Notice of Delisting or Failure to Satisfy a Continued Listing Rule or Standard; Transfer of Listing. On August 21, 2026, Nasdaq Stock Market LLC (“Nasdaq”) notified Fathom Holdings Inc. (the “Company”) that for the last 30 consecutive business days, the bid price for the Company’s common stock had closed below the minimum $1.00 per share requirement for continued inclusion on the Nasdaq Capital Market pursuant to Nasdaq Listing Rule 5550(a)(2) (the “Bid Price Rule”).
